Astronaut Jerry L. Ross, STS-110 mission specialist, assisted by diver Danny Brandon, Jr., floats in a small life raft during an emergency egress training session at the Neutral Buoyancy Laboratory (NBL) near the Johnson Space Center (JSC). STS-110 will be the 13th shuttle mission to visit the International Space Station (ISS).
